Picking the Right Directional TV Antenna for Your Setup

Range Claims vs. Real-World Performance

Manufacturers advertise enormous mile ranges, often in the thousands, because those numbers describe laboratory-best reception. In a real living room or RV, building materials, terrain, and distance from broadcast towers shrink that range dramatically. The honest read is that anything beyond 30 to 50 miles of true range requires outdoor mounting at height, and even then, hills and trees get in the way. Use advertised range as a starting point, not a promise, and pair it with online tools that map your local broadcast towers.

Indoor vs. Outdoor Placement

Indoor antennas are easier to install and renter-friendly, but walls, foil-backed insulation, and metal siding all block signal. Outdoor antennas mounted high on a roof or eave pull in dramatically more channels in most situations, at the cost of installation effort. The picks on this list work indoors, but several are rated for outdoor use in a covered location. Pick based on how permanent you want the install and whether drilling into exterior surfaces is even an option.

Cable Length and Cable Management

Cable length is one of those specs that sounds minor until you live with too little of it. A 25-foot cable is fine for a studio apartment; a basement media room with the only window at the far end of the house needs 38 feet or more. Excess cable, on the other hand, becomes a tangle behind the TV stand, so match length to layout rather than just grabbing the longest option available.

TV Compatibility and Broadcast Standards

A modern 4K HDR television deserves an antenna that won’t bottleneck its picture quality, while an older set in the garage just needs basic digital reception. ATSC 3.0 support is a forward-looking feature; if your TV decodes it, you’ll appreciate it as more markets upgrade their transmitters, but it’s not essential today.

Things Worth Knowing Before You Choose

Where Shoppers Go Wrong

The most common mistake is buying the highest-mileage antenna and expecting it to solve every signal problem. Amplifiers help at the edge of reception range, but they also amplify noise when stations are already strong, sometimes producing fewer usable channels than a simpler model. Another frequent misstep is choosing a flat panel that looks clean on a wall but then mounting it where the signal path is blocked by brick or metal siding. Always check your local broadcast tower map and identify the nearest window in that direction before settling on a placement spot.

What Separates Premium From Basic

Higher-tier antennas in this category tend to add stronger filtering against cellular and FM interference, more refined amplifier designs that handle strong-signal environments gracefully, and sturdier weather-resistant builds for outdoor mounting. For most households, a mid-tier option covers everything, but if you live where towers are far apart and interference is heavy, the upgrade pays off in channel stability rather than headline range.

Frequently Asked Questions

Do I need a directional or omnidirectional antenna?

Directional antennas point at one tower for maximum reach, while omnidirectional designs pull in signals from every direction. Omnidirectional is easier and works for most households; directional only wins when you’re far from a single cluster of towers.

Can I install an indoor antenna without drilling?

Yes. Most flat-panel antennas use adhesive strips or simply lean against a window. Renters should test placement with removable tape before committing to a permanent mount.

How many free channels can I realistically expect?

Channel counts vary by market. Urban areas near multiple broadcast towers often pull in 50 to 100 channels including subchannels; rural areas may only receive a handful of major networks.

Will weather affect reception?

Heavy rain and storms can temporarily weaken over-the-air signals, especially at the edge of range. Mounting the antenna in a sheltered spot and securing cable connections helps minimize weather-related dropouts.

Do I need to rescan channels periodically?

Yes. Broadcasters occasionally change frequencies or add subchannels, and a periodic channel rescan on your TV keeps your lineup current.
